Eula Ledgerwood Papers
Scope and Contents
The Eula Ledgerwood Papers, which date from 1920 through 1923, contain a scrapbook of items related to student life at Whitman College, especially sorority life. The collection also includes dance souvenirs and other ephemera, a booklet on Whitman College Women's Association Self-Government, a poster of "Regulations governing conduct of freshmen women," photographs, and programs from various Whitman theatrical and musical productions.

Biographical Note
Eula Victoria Ledgerwood Jesseph was born on September 18, 1902. She attended Whitman College, class of 1924. She died on June 9, 1988.

Abstract
The Eula Ledgerwood Papers contain materials related to the student life of Eula Ledgerwood, a Whitman College alumna. These papers, which span from 1920 through 1923, consist of a scrapbook, dance souvenirs, and booklets.
Immediate Source of Acquisition
Donated to the Whitman College and Northwest Archives by Eula Victoria Ledgerwood Jesseph on May 2, 1986. The accession number associated with this donation is retro-0392.
